A successful LED Lighting Installation requires a nuanced understanding of spatial style and light distribution to guarantee every room achieves the wanted environment and utility. In contemporary domestic settings, the inherent versatility of these systems permits the creation of advanced, layered lighting schemes that can transition from high-intensity job lighting in a kitchen area to a soft, ambient glow in a master suite. When planning an LED Lighting Installation, it is important to concentrate on the lumen output and colour rendering index instead of conventional wattage, as these metrics figure out the real quality and brightness of the lighting. Professional installers in the region are experienced at calculating the accurate positioning of downlights to prevent the cluttered look of an over-saturated ceiling while making sure that no dark shadows persist in living locations. Technical safety and regulative compliance are critical pillars of any electrical job, and the process of LED Lighting Installation is no exception to these rigid requirements. While some may view this as a basic task, a comprehensive LED Lighting Installation involves browsing intricate circuitry, making sure driver compatibility, and mitigating fire dangers associated with improper clearance from ceiling insulation. Certified electrical experts make sure that every component integrated throughout an LED Lighting Installation is fitted with suitable thermal defense which existing dimmer switches work with the new technology to avoid flickering or audible buzzing.
